2026/5/21 20:09:29
网站建设
项目流程
html模板素材,泉州百度推广排名优化,网站信息建设,深圳推广公司排行榜快速体验
打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容#xff1a;
快速开发音源管理平台原型#xff0c;核心功能#xff1a;1. 音源链接提交表单 2. 链接验证功能 3. 分类标签系统 4. 基础搜索 5. 用户收藏夹。使用最低可行产品(MVP)原则#…快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容快速开发音源管理平台原型核心功能1. 音源链接提交表单 2. 链接验证功能 3. 分类标签系统 4. 基础搜索 5. 用户收藏夹。使用最低可行产品(MVP)原则优先实现核心流程。技术栈Node.jsExpress后端SQLite数据库简单HTML前端。要求24小时内完成可演示版本。点击项目生成按钮等待项目生成完整后预览效果最近接了个需求要快速搭建一个音源管理平台的原型。甲方要求24小时内看到可演示版本还要包含核心功能。这种紧急项目最适合用InsCode(快马)平台来实现了不用折腾环境配置直接在线开发部署特别省时间。需求分析与MVP规划首先明确最核心的五个功能点音源链接提交、链接验证、分类标签、基础搜索和用户收藏。按照MVP原则先保证主流程跑通其他优化功能可以后续迭代。我决定用Node.jsExpress做后端SQLite存数据前端先用简单HTML页面快速呈现。数据库设计为了节省时间数据库只设计了三张表音源表存储链接、标题、描述等基础信息标签表实现分类功能用户收藏表记录用户收藏关系 用SQLite的好处是不用单独部署数据库服务一个文件就能搞定。后端开发后端主要实现四个接口提交音源接口包含链接有效性校验标签管理接口支持添加/查询标签搜索接口按关键词模糊匹配收藏接口用户操作和查询 链接验证功能我直接用正则表达式检查格式暂时没做深度校验这是MVP阶段可以接受的妥协。前端实现前端页面做了三个提交页面表单提交按钮展示页面列表形式展示音源搜索页面搜索框结果展示 没用任何前端框架纯HTMLCSS快速撸出来重点突出功能而非美观。难点与解决方案开发过程中遇到两个主要问题链接验证的误判有些特殊格式的链接会被错误拦截临时放宽了正则规则搜索性能问题数据量稍大就变慢先加了简单缓存机制应急 这些都是可以后续优化的点但MVP阶段先保证功能可用。部署上线在InsCode(快马)平台上一键部署特别方便不用操心服务器配置。平台自动处理了运行环境生成的可访问链接直接发给甲方验收。整个开发过程大概用了18小时比预期还提前完成。这种快速原型开发最关键的是要克制完美主义先做出能演示核心功能的最小版本。后续如果甲方确认需求再考虑用更完善的技术栈重构。通过这次实战我发现InsCode(快马)平台特别适合快速验证想法从编码到部署的整个流程都很顺畅。尤其是部署环节传统方式可能要折腾半天服务器配置在这里点个按钮就搞定了省下的时间可以用来完善业务逻辑。快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容快速开发音源管理平台原型核心功能1. 音源链接提交表单 2. 链接验证功能 3. 分类标签系统 4. 基础搜索 5. 用户收藏夹。使用最低可行产品(MVP)原则优先实现核心流程。技术栈Node.jsExpress后端SQLite数据库简单HTML前端。要求24小时内完成可演示版本。点击项目生成按钮等待项目生成完整后预览效果